首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

了解如何使用ES6模板文字中的元素设置CSS网格格式

ES6模板文字是一种在JavaScript中使用的字符串模板语法,它允许我们在字符串中插入变量或表达式,并且可以方便地设置CSS网格格式。

CSS网格布局是一种强大的布局系统,它可以将页面划分为行和列的网格,使我们能够更灵活地控制页面布局。在ES6模板文字中,我们可以使用${}语法来插入CSS网格相关的样式。

下面是一个示例,展示了如何使用ES6模板文字中的元素设置CSS网格格式:

代码语言:txt
复制
const container = document.querySelector('.container');
const items = ['item1', 'item2', 'item3'];

const gridTemplate = `
  display: grid;
  grid-template-columns: repeat(3, 1fr);
  grid-gap: 10px;
`;

container.style.cssText = gridTemplate;

items.forEach(item => {
  const element = document.createElement('div');
  element.textContent = item;
  container.appendChild(element);
});

在上面的示例中,我们首先通过querySelector方法获取到一个具有.container类名的容器元素。然后,我们定义了一个gridTemplate变量,使用ES6模板文字的语法设置了CSS网格相关的样式。最后,我们通过style.cssText属性将这些样式应用到容器元素上。

在这个例子中,我们将容器元素的布局设置为3列的网格布局,每列的宽度平均分配(1fr),并且设置了10像素的间隔。然后,我们使用forEach方法遍历items数组,创建了三个div元素,并将它们添加到容器中。

这样,我们就使用ES6模板文字中的元素设置了CSS网格格式。这种方式可以使我们的代码更加简洁和可读,并且方便地应用CSS网格布局。

腾讯云提供了一系列云计算产品,其中包括云服务器、云数据库、云存储等,可以满足各种云计算需求。具体产品介绍和相关链接可以参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券